Hello everyone, I just picked up a 2006 Mazda3 Hatchback 5 Door, A/T. MSRP $18,880. No other options added. I paid $18,000 before taxes, fees, etc. Clean sale. Besides tax and license, I was only charged doc. fees. of $45. Do you think I got a good deal? Dealer showed me an invoice price of $17,897. Edmunds.com shows $17,677. Did I miss something? Was this a good price for So.Cal? Any chances that I could have gotten the car under invoice? I did not shop around that much, but I feel that I got a decent deal since I got a good trade in figure for my 2000 Protege. The Internet Sales Manager stated the M3 is still hot. I appreciate your thoughts. Thanks. P.S. He did mention he'll send me a booklet w/coupons and for the 1st year, every other oil change will be on the house. |
